site stats

Preemptive round robin scheduling example

WebRR Scheduling Example. In the following example, there are six processes named as P1, P2, P3, P4, P5 and P6. Their arrival time and burst time are given below in the table. The time … WebOct 1, 2024 · So, we can say that Round Robin is a special kind of Preemptive Priority Scheduling Algorithm where a process in the ready queue gets its priority increased and a …

Round Robin Scheduling Examples - Gate Vidyalay

WebAn example of a multilevel feedback queue can be seen in the above figure. Explanation: First of all, Suppose that queues 1 and 2 follow round robin with time quantum 8 and 16 respectively and queue 3 follows FCFS. One of the implementations of Multilevel Feedback Queue Scheduling is as follows: Web5.6.3 Example: Linux Scheduling. Modern Linux scheduling provides improved support for SMP systems, and a scheduling algorithm that runs in O(1) time as the number of processes increases. The Linux scheduler is a preemptive priority-based algorithm with two priority ranges - Real time from 0 to 99 and a nice range from 100 to 140. how has samsung been innovative https://estatesmedcenter.com

Priority Scheduling Algorithm: Preemptive, Non …

WebApr 2, 2024 · For example, Windows NT/XP/Vista uses a multilevel feedback queue, a combination of fixed-priority preemptive scheduling, round-robin, and first in, first out algorithms. In this system, threads can dynamically increase or decrease in priority depending on if it has been serviced already, or if it has been waiting extensively. WebNov 3,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ebJan 17, 2024 · One important scheduling algorithm for real-time or embedded system is priority round robin scheduling algorithm. Priority round robin scheduling algorithm is a preemptive algorithm. Each process ... how has schizophrenia changed over time

Round Robin Scheduling Algorithm with Example - Guru99

Category:Round Robin(RR) CPU Scheduling Algorithm in OS with example

Tags:Preemptive round robin scheduling example

Preemptive round robin scheduling example

What is Round Robin Scheduling (RRS)? – Definition & Example

WebFinal answer. 11. Consider the following workload: a) Show the schedule using shortest remaining time, nonpreemptive priority (a smaller priority number implies higher priority) and round robin with quantum 30 ms. Use time scale diagram as shown below for the FCFS example to show the schedule for each requested scheduling policy. WebRecall: Round-Robin Scheduling (RR) •Give out small units of PU time (“time quantum”) •Typically 10 –100 milliseconds •When quantum expires, preempt, and schedule •Round Robin: add to end of the queue •Each of N processes gets ~1/N of CPU (in window) •With quantum length Q ms, process waits at most (N-1)*Q ms to run again

Preemptive round robin scheduling example

Did you know?

WebJan 31, 2024 · What is Priority Scheduling? Priority Scheduling is a method of scheduling processes that is based on priority. In this algorithm, the scheduler selects the tasks to … WebMar 24, 2024 · For detailed implementation of Non-Preemptive Shortest Job First scheduling ... as 0, so turn around and completion times are same. Examples to show working of Non-Preemptive Shortest Job First CPU Scheduling Algorithm: Example-1: ... Difference between Shortest Job First (SJF) and Round-Robin (RR) scheduling …

WebIn case of a tie, it is broken by FCFS Scheduling. Priority Scheduling can be used in both preemptive and non-preemptive mode. Advantages- It considers the priority of the processes and allows the important processes to run first. Priority scheduling in preemptive mode is best suited for real time operating system. Disadvantages- WebSep 22, 2024 · 大致翻译:这里有五个进程以P1,P2,P3,P4,P5的顺序同时在0时刻到达,画出FCFS,SJF,非抢占式优先级和RR(时间片长度为2)的甘特图,写出上述四种算法得轮转时间、等待时间和最小平均等待时间。. 知识点:对调度算法的理解,甘特图的绘制。.

WebDefinition: Round robin scheduling is the preemptive scheduling in which every process get executed in a cyclic way, i.e. in this a particular time slice is allotted to each process … WebThe following processes are being scheduled using a preemptive, roundrobin scheduling algorithm. ... For round-robin scheduling, the length of a time quantum is 10 milliseconds. ... One approach is to place all tasks in a single unordered list, where the strategy for task selection depends on the scheduling algorithm. For example, ...

WebApr 29, 2024 · The round-robin concept is a method of assigning a task to the CPU. In this algorithm, each individual gets an equal amount of something, in turn, inspired by the name of this method. It is the simplest and oldest scheduling method, and it is mostly used for multitasking. Round-robin scheduling allows each ready job to run in a cyclic queue for ...

Web5 Example for Round Robin: Department of Computer Science,KITSW Page 6 .time sharing (preemptive) scheduler where each process is given access to the CPU for 1 time quantum (slice) (e.g., 20 milliseconds) 1. a process may block itself before its time slice expires 2. if it uses its entire time slice, it is then preempted and put at the end of ... how has school lunches changed over timeWeb4. When a process switches from the waiting state to the ready state. 5. When a process terminates. GMU – CS 571 Non-preemptive vs. Preemptive Scheduling Under non-preemptive scheduling, each running process keeps the CPU until it completes or it switches to the waiting (blocked) state (points 2 and 5 from previous slides). highest rated online banks checking 2017WebMar 21, 2024 · Round robin is a preemptive algorithm. Widely used scheduling method in traditional OS. Time slice should be minimum, assigned for a specific task that needs to be processed. However, it may differ from OS to OS. The process that is preempted is added to the end of the queue. how has russia attacked ukraineWebWhich scheduling algorithm is preemptive? Round Robin is the preemptive process scheduling algorithm. Each process is provided a fix time to execute, it is called a quantum. Once a process is executed for a given time period, it is preempted and other process executes for a given time period. Which is the most commonly used scheduling policy in ... highest rated online bulk herbsWebFeb 24, 2024 · The following processes are being scheduled using a preemptive, round robin scheduling algorithm. Each process is assigned a numerical priority, with a higher number … how has russia contributed to world cultureHere are the important characteristics of Round-Robin Scheduling: 1. Round robin is a pre-emptive algorithm 2. The CPU is shifted to the next process after fixed interval time, which is called time quantum/time slice. 3. The process that is preempted is added to the end of the queue. 4. Round robin is a hybrid model … See more Consider this following three processes Step 1)The execution begins with process P1, which has burst time 4. Here, every process executes for 2 seconds. P2 and P3 are still in the waiting queue. Step 2) At time =2, P1 is added … See more Here, are pros/benefits of Round-robin scheduling method: 1. It doesn’t face the issues of starvation or convoy effect. 2. All the jobs get a fair allocation of CPU. 3. It deals with all process without any priority 4. If you know the … See more This term is used for the maximum time taken for execution of all the tasks. 1. dt = Denote detection time when a task is brought into the list 2. st = Denote switching time from … See more Here, are drawbacks/cons of using Round-robin scheduling: 1. If slicing time of OS is low, the processor output will be reduced. 2. This method spends more time on context switching 3. Its performance heavily depends on … See more how has samsung innovatedWebOct 22, 2013 · The call will enable the scheduler which will then check the states of all the tasks within the system and schedule the highest priority ready task. Algorithms vary slightly, for example a task make be allowed to run until all its inputs are consumed or a “round robin” scheduling may be implemented whereby each task of equal priority is run … highest rated online banks